Crafting Hits: The Songwriting Journey of Miguel Armenta in Música Mexicana
Miguel Armenta, a talented singer-songwriter with over 60 song credits, has made a significant impact on the música mexicana scene. His ability to craft songs that resonate with artists like Fuerza Regida, Tito Double P, Peso Pluma, and Dareyes de la Sierra showcases his skill as a songwriter. Armenta's approach to songwriting involves tailoring the sound to fit the artist's vocal timbre and intention, ensuring a perfect match.
Armenta's songwriting process is both intuitive and inspired. From writing Fuerza Regida's hit "Marlboro Rojo" in just 45 minutes to creating "Dos Días" for Tito Double P and Peso Pluma after a wild night out, his songs are infused with emotion and authenticity. His focus is always on conveying feelings that resonate with listeners, allowing them to immerse themselves in the music.
Having worked closely with artists like Tito Double P and Peso Pluma, Armenta has been instrumental in shaping their musical careers. His contributions to Tito Double P's debut album "Incómodo" and their joint LP "Dinastía" have been well-received by fans and critics alike. Armenta's collaboration with the cousins on stage for the song "London" has further solidified his place in the música mexicana realm.
Armenta's journey into music was not a straightforward one, initially pursuing a degree in biomedical engineering before fully embracing his passion for songwriting. His early experiences with music, from writing lyrics in journals to composing his first R&B song at 18, laid the foundation for his future success. Collaborating with artists like Angel Ureta and signing with Street Mob Records marked the beginning of his career in the music industry.
The success of songs like "Bebe Dame" with Fuerza Regida and Grupo Frontera's joint EP "Mala Mía" highlights Armenta's ability to create hits that resonate with audiences. His collaborations with renowned songwriter Edgar Barrera have led to chart-topping tracks and Latin Grammy nominations for Fuerza Regida and Grupo Frontera. Armenta's dedication to evolving the sound of música mexicana ensures that the genre continues to thrive.
Armenta's achievements have not gone unnoticed, with several of his songs receiving recognition at the BMI Latin Awards. Tracks like "Bebe Dame," "Me Jalo," and "TQM" have earned him accolades for his songwriting prowess. Looking ahead, Armenta remains committed to his craft, with aspirations of winning Grammy Awards and establishing his own publishing label for songwriters and composers.
